Output 75997de043961d746c072bb07b0d966b740614cc30f3af0a697dc6379596a161:2

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94ea49e50293aa51a45223b3cd569fbb7ff0968d OP_EQUAL
address
A61fLSZNeAhbVKpHnK6HXfNQ62PutFKRDB
transaction
75997de043961d746c072bb07b0d966b740614cc30f3af0a697dc6379596a161